Doing this morning stretch routine before you get out of bed can be very helpful. These morning stretches will not only get the blood circulating in your body, but they will also loosen up the joints to get you moving without pain. For the stretches, we will do just 30 seconds 2 times verses three to save some time and since you probably haven’t warmed up, these are really just to get the blood flowing before you get up. Start off with some knee to chest stretches. Bend one knee and bring your leg up to your chest as far as you comfortably can. Hold this for 30 seconds and do it two times on each side.
Next, you will stretch your hamstrings. This stretch is called an active assisted stretch because you are actively doing the stretch. Grab the back of your thigh, and bring your hip to about 90 degrees. Slowly start to straighten your leg until you feel a good stretch as seen in the video. Not everyone will be able to straighten their knee completely. Do two sets of 30 seconds on each side.
Now try some gentle trunk rotation stretches on your back with your knees bent in hooklying. Gently rotate your bent legs from side to side. You can hold them on each side for 3-5 seconds or you can continuously rotate them back and forth. Again, try to keep your lower back on the ground.
Finally, you will do bridging. Push your bottom up off the ground, but try to do this slowly, and do one segment of your back at a time curling upward. Then slowly go down the same way, one segment at a time.
